What Are Retinoids?

Retinoids are a class of Vitamin A-derived compounds typically used as cosmetic treatments. They are powerful antioxidants that have both short-term benefits and long-term, age-defying effects on your skin. Retinoids — such as retinol, tretinoin, adapalene, and tazarotene — help fade fine lines and wrinkles, reduce hyperpigmentation, improve collagen production, and even out skin texture.

The Benefits of Retinoids for Skin Health

Retinoids can help reduce wrinkles and fine lines that are the result of sun damage, aging, and gravity by increasing cell turnover and collagen production. They can also enhance the skin’s ability to retain moisture, decrease inflammation, and fight acne by encouraging shedding of dead skin cells and unclogging pores. Additionally, retinoids can help even out skin tone and diminish the appearance of age spots. Retinoids work gradually over time, so results can be seen in a few weeks, with the full benefits becoming apparent after several months of regular use.

The Health and Safety of Retinoids

Retinoids are considered safe for topical use, though irritation and redness may occur when first starting. To minimize irritation and maximize the benefits, start slow and apply retinoids every other day until your skin has become accustomed to them. In addition, be sure to use a sunscreen while using retinoids as they can make your skin more sensitive to the sun.
